The 2021 FIS Ski Jumping Grand Prix was the 28th Summer Grand Prix season in ski jumping for men and the 10th for women.[1]
Other competitive circuits this season included the World Cup, Continental Cup, FIS Cup, FIS Race and Alpen Cup.

The table shows the number of points won in the 2021 FIS Ski Jumping Grand Prix for men and women.
width=150 | Place | width=25 | 1 | width=25 | 2 | width=25 | 3 | width=25 | 4 | width=25 | 5 | width=25 | 6 | width=25 | 7 | width=25 | 8 | width=25 | 9 | width=25 | 10 | width=25 | 11 | width=25 | 12 | width=25 | 13 | width=25 | 14 | width=25 | 15 | width=25 | 16 | width=25 | 17 | width=25 | 18 | width=25 | 19 | width=25 | 20 | width=25 | 21 | width=25 | 22 | width=25 | 23 | width=25 | 24 | width=25 | 25 | width=25 | 26 | width=25 | 27 | width=25 | 28 | width=25 | 29 | width=25 | 30 |
|
Individual | 100 | 80 | 60 | 50 | 45 | 40 | 36 | 32 | 29 | 26 | 24 | 22 | 20 | 18 | 16 | 15 | 14 | 13 | 12 | 11 | 10 | 9 | 8 | 7 | 6 | 5 | 4 | 3 | 2 | 1 |
Mixed Team | 200 | 175 | 150 | 125 | 100 | 75 | 50 | 25 | |
